Default SD buck down!!

Saturday Oct 7th. I walked to my ground blind that I have set on a dugout and crawled in. 3:00 pm and it is 90 and the wind is 15-30mph from the south. I sit till 6:40 with no action. HOT!!! I am wondering what I was thinking sitting here in this heat and wind. The moon has been full so I am sure they are moving late but the wind direction was perfect. Finally a doe and her twin button bucks showup and drink. Before they are done another doe and her twin doeand button show up. They drink and headback the way they came. Then a lone doe shows up followed by another set of twins and there mom. Both fawns are does this time. Then a few lone does and a spike buck. Lots of deer and action. They all drink and mill around for awhile and move off to a cut hay field. It is getting close to sunset and the spike shows up again. He is not alone this time. At 45 yds the spike and the other buck spare lightly and work down to the water. He does not give me a shot for the first few minutes. He comes around the water and stops 12 yds below my blind. Quarted to me slighly but I took the shot. He runs about 40 yds and looks back. He and the spike have no idea what happened. He dropped there and the spike was really lost and finally moved away. I have not scored him but am happy with him. My best deer so far!!
